A Mathematical Equation For Chasing Your Dreams w/ Logan Gelbrich — Barbell Shrugged #384
Born in Santa Monica, Logan feels right at home coaching at DEUCE Gym. With a background in collegiate (University of San Diego) and professional (San Diego Padres) baseball, Logan is used to high performance, heavy workloads, and accountability. Luckily, Logan was blessed enough to work with world renowned strength and conditioning coaches, sports psychologists, and nutritionists during his career. It's during this time that the seeds were sown for the belief system that guides his coaching today. Forever a "student of the game," Logan is always looking to strengthen and question his understanding of human movement and nutrition. In this episode of Barbell Shrugged we talk with Logan about making conscious decisions, the difference between those who are still in the game in their 30's and those who burn out at 25, the pursuit of truth, why you need to balance out the positive with the negative, a deep dive into depression, building something that will transcend yourself, finding environments that you can commit to a practice of deep work in, Logans upcoming book, and much more. To Have Strength, You Need Mobility: How to Improve Performance and Reduce Injury and Pain with a Mobility Practice with Dr. Grayson Wickham — Muscle Maven Radio Episode #7
From the age of nine when he received a copy of Arnold Schwarzenegger's Encyclopedia of Modern Bodybuilding as a gift, Dr. Grayson Wickham has been fascinated with movement. He earned a Bachelors of Science, majoring in exercise science and kinesiology, and received a Doctorate of Physical Therapy at the University of Wisconsin- Madison. He is a physical therapist and a certified strength and conditioning specialist, working with everyone from NFL, MLB, professional tennis players and professional CrossFit athletes, to those that are just touching a barbell for the first time. Grayson is known to experiment with different types of systems and movement philosophies, trying to find the most effective ways to optimize movement, while decreasing pain, and increasing performance. He's based in New York City where he runs his online mobility coaching practice Movement Vault, and teaches mobility and movement workshops all over the world. In this episode Ashleigh talks with Dr. Grayson Wickham, a physical therapist, strength and conditioning coach, and founder of Movement Vault, about mobility: the difference between mobility and flexibility, how to recognize and address your own imbalances and weaknesses before you become injured, and how to implement a thoughtful and sustainable mobility practice to improve general movement, pain and injury management, and performance. The Art of Breath: How Controlling Your Breath Can Improve Your Health, Physical Performance, and Mental Function with Rob Wilson — Muscle Maven Radio Episode #6
Rob Wilson (@preparetoperform) is a coach with Power Speed Endurance which is a programming, coaching and educational platform for developing sports performance, fitness and health—and it's not only for high level endurance athletes but anyone looking to improve their health and fitness through increased movement efficiency and better mechanics. Rob travels the country teaching the Art of Breath clinic, covering the theory and practical applications of oxygen and c02 efficiency, proper body and breathing mechanics for increased movement efficiency, and much more. Rob has 15 years of experience in manual therapy, he co-owns CrossFit Virginia Beach with his wife, and he's worked with Kelly Starrett on the Mobility WOD staff before he helped develop the Art of Breath seminar for Power Speed Endurance. In this episode Ashleigh talks with Rob Wilson, a CrossFit gym owner and movement and breath specialist about the course he developed with Brian Mackenzie for Power Speed Endurance called The Art of Breath – it's a masterclass clinic on breath work, including how mindful practice and control of your breath can have positive effects on health, fitness performance, and mental health and cognition. We talk about why you should breath through your nose almost all the time, especially when you're training; what the diaphragm is and why it's so important; how to increase carbon dioxide tolerance; mobilizing your body effectively to use your lungs to the fullest; and actual breath work techniques that enhance your physical performance and manage stress. Fixing The Broken Fitness System with OPEX Founder James FitzGerald— Barbell Shrugged #381
Inaugural CrossFit Games Champion and industry-leading educator, James FitzGerald, has dedicated his life to bringing honor to the coaching profession. As Founder of OPEX Fitness his Coaching Education and Gyms Licensing Programs have provided thousands of coaches with the tools needed to professionalize their passion. James' flagship program, The OPEX Coaching Certificate Program reflects his 20 + years of coaching expertise and is set apart by the breadth of coaching theory and practical application taught.
